Set in contemporary London, this comedic stage play explores themes of blackmail, political corruption, and the dichotomy of public versus private honor. Over the course of twenty-four hours, characters grapple with their past actions and the consequences they entail. Wilde emphasizes that while everyone must eventually face the repercussions of their deeds, one's past should not define them entirely. Alongside The Importance of Being Earnest, it stands as one of Wilde's most celebrated works, showcasing his sharp wit and social commentary.
